Understanding the Tone Generator

A tone generator is a handheld device that emits a specific sound or tone when connected to a wire. This sound helps electricians identify and trace wires within complex wiring systems, especially when multiple cables run through walls or conduits.

Best Practices for Using a Tone Generator

  • Label Wires Clearly: Before using the tone generator, label each wire with tags or markers to avoid confusion.
  • Verify the Correct Wire: Use a multimeter or continuity tester to confirm the wire you plan to trace is the correct one.
  • Connect Properly: Attach the tone generator’s probe securely to the wire you want to trace, ensuring good contact.
  • Use the Correct Frequency: Select the appropriate tone frequency to distinguish between multiple wires in close proximity.
  • Maintain Safety: Turn off power to the circuit before connecting the tone generator to prevent electrical hazards.
  • Trace Step-by-Step: Follow the wire carefully, listening for the tone, and confirm the wire’s path before proceeding.
  • Document Findings: Record the wire routes and labels to assist in future troubleshooting or modifications.
